Please help!! How do you say, "I think I have bronchitis" in Korean?
I plan to visit the hospital today (I live in Korea) and I need to know how to properly say this! I know for a fact that I have more than a cold and I don't want them giving me cold medicine again hahaha. I know that bronchitis is 기관지염, but I don't know how to say it clearly enough that my point will get across.
I want to know:
1) " I think I have bronchitis."
2) "I have a cough, runny nose, and I feel very fatigued."

1) i think cold is totally different disease from bronchitis. it is worse than flu.. right?
저는 단순히 감기가 아니라 독감을 넘어서서 기관지염까지 악화 된거 같아요. ( this sentence could explain this situation)
2) 저 지금 기침 많이하고, 콧물 흐르고, 그리고 정말 피곤해요, 오한이 들어요.
in my opinion, Doctor in korea is most well educated so they can understand what you want in English,
몸 조심하세요 ㅜㅜ
